dear gmx-users, my simulation has been running for sometime but now I want to know how long is left for the simulation to be completed. I need help with the command to analyse a running simulation.
The -v option of mdrun prints a running estimate of time remaining, but if you didn't use it then it's no use to you during an ongoing run. Otherwise, just use tail on the .log file to see how far along things are.
